1. A system for the remediation of non-compliant environmental impact items located at remote locations by an infield operator comprising:

  • a server having a server non-transitory computer readable medium and a server processor wherein said server is in electronic communication with a remote computing device;

    a database representing a set of inspection items to be inspected by the infield operator, wherein each inspection item includes an inspection set, wherein each inspection set includes item information, inspection protocol, inspection frequency, remediation action, notification, and compliance information, wherein each inspection item is taken from the group consisting of;

    groundwater set, stormwater set, baghouse set, and large quantity container set; and

    ,server computer readable instructions stored on said server non-transitory computer readable medium that, when executed by said processor, provide for;

    receiving item information representing an inspection item that the infield operator wishes to inspect;

    retrieving said inspection protocol associated with said inspection item that the infield operator wishes to inspect from said database;

    transmitting said retrieved protocol to said remote computing device representing steps to be taken by the infield operator to conduct an inspection of the inspection item that the infield operator wishes to inspect;

    receiving an inspection result from said remote computing device representing a measurement taken for one of said inspection items inspected by the infield operator wherein said inspection result includes a date and time the result was collected, a physical location where the result was collected, and an infield operator identification representing the infield operator conducting the inspection;

    retrieving said compliance information associated with said inspection item that the infield operator wishes to inspect from said database;

    comparing said retrieved compliance information with said inspection result to determine whether said inspection result is in compliance or non-compliant;

    storing said inspection result in said server non-transitory computer readable medium if said inspection result is in compliance;

    transmitting a repeat measurement request to said remote computing device if said inspection result is non-compliant thereby requesting that the inspection be repeated;

    receiving a second inspection result;

    comparing said retrieved compliance information with said second inspection result to determine whether said second inspection result is in compliance or non-compliant;

    storing said second inspection result in said server non-transitory computer readable medium if said compliance result is in compliance;

    transmitting said remediation action associated with said inspection item that the infield operator wishes to inspect to said remote computing device according to said retrieved inspection protocol if said second inspection result is non-compliant thereby requesting said infield operator to perform the transmitted remediation action;

    receiving a remediation action status indicator from said remote computing device wherein said remediation action status indicator is taken from the group consisting of;

    remediation action not preformed, remediation action preformed, remediation action taken and non-compliance resolved, and remediation action taken and non-compliance not resolved;

    transmitting a second repeat measurement request to said remote computing device if said remediation action status indicator is remediation action taken and non-compliance resolved;

    receiving a third inspection result;

    comparing said retrieved compliance information with said third inspection result to determine whether said third inspection result is in compliance or non-compliant; and

    ,storing said third inspection result in said server non-transitory computer readable medium if said third inspection result is in compliance.
